2025 Global Money Week

Global Money Week is an annual event aimed at raising awareness about responsible money management. It promotes financial education from an early age, particularly for children and adolescents, by developing skills for making sound financial decisions.

Global Money Week 2025 Theme

In 2025, Global Money Week will be celebrated from March 18 to March 24, under the theme: “Protect Your Money, Secure Your Future.”

This year’s theme focuses on safe money management and emphasizes the importance of adopting a responsible and informed approach to personal finances. It highlights the need to be aware of potential financial risks and to protect hard-earned money.

Common risks include financial fraud, phishing scams, online shopping scams, and data privacy threats such as identity theft. Young people are particularly vulnerable to these risks due to their limited financial literacy and experience.

Origins of Global Money Week

Global Money Week was established in 2012 by the International Network on Financial Education (INFE), a division of the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D).

The initiative aims to create a global awareness campaign focused on teaching children and young people essential financial concepts to help them develop skills for making informed financial decisions that impact their future.

It is supported by financial institutions, educational organizations, finance experts, and other companies, who work together to organize free digital educational activities. Since its inception, the campaign has reached over 53 million children and young people in 176 countries worldwide.

Money Management Tips

Here are some key recommendations for saving and using money efficiently:

• Create a savings plan: Set clear, realistic financial goals, such as education, buying a car or home, or taking a dream vacation.

• Make a detailed budget: Track your income and expenses monthly to manage your finances effectively.

• Set a savings target: Ideally, save 5-10% of your income each month based on your budget.

• Open a bank account: Choose a bank that offers financial products suited to your needs and goals.

• Avoid unnecessary expenses: Eliminate non-essential spending from your budget to maximize savings.

• Monitor your finances: Regularly review your expenses and bank account transactions to adjust your budget as needed.

How is Global Money Week Celebrated?

During Global Money Week, free financial education resources will be available for children, young people, and adults. Through interactive and engaging activities, participants will learn about money management, the importance of saving, and essential skills for financial success.

The event features fairs, workshops, conferences, podcasts, live broadcasts, and other events, all designed to promote financial literacy and responsible money habits.

Miami, FL – The Consulate General of the Dominican Republic in Miami made history with an unforgettable celebration of Dominican Independence, marking a milestone in the Dominican Week Abroad initiative. The grand finale of this event was a spectacular Gala Dinner, led by Dr. Geanilda Vásquez, that ignited Dominican pride and emotion among attendees.

A NIGHT TO REMEMBER

This historic celebration, held with the support of Grupo SID, saw the presence of high-level executives José Miguel Bonetti and Mariel López, as well as Celinés Toribio, Vice Minister for Dominican Communities Abroad and Director of INDEX, along with Richard Montilla from INDEX Miami. The evening took an emotional turn when, to the surprise and delight of the audience, Grammy-winning merengue artist Manny Cruz took the stage unexpectedly, leaving many guests in tears of joy.

Before the musical surprise, Geanilda Vásquez addressed the audience, emphasizing the government’s commitment to the diaspora and highlighting President Luis Abinader’s efforts in recognizing the contributions of Dominicans abroad.

“I am immensely happy to celebrate our Dominican identity with this vibrant diaspora in Miami, especially on the most significant national holiday—our Independence Day. This event holds even greater meaning as we commemorate it from foreign soil, thanks to the joint efforts of our consulate, the business sector, and government agencies,” Vásquez stated, visibly moved.

She also praised the Dominican community in Florida, recalling the efforts of the founding fathers of Dominican independence, as the country celebrated its 181st anniversary in February.

RECOGNIZING THE STRENGTH OF THE DIASPORA

Celinés Toribio, making her first public appearance with the Miami diaspora as Vice Minister of MIREX and Director of INDEX, reaffirmed her commitment to supporting Dominicans abroad through INDEX’s various programs.

The gala, held at the elegant EB Hotel, was hosted by renowned Dominican media personalities Luz García and Mariela Encarnación. The event brought together distinguished figures from the Dominican diaspora, including INDEX representative Soledad Cruz, who emphasized the collaborative efforts that made the celebration possible.

A STUNNING SURPRISE: MANNY CRUZ TAKES THE STAGE

One of the most unforgettable moments of the evening was when Manny Cruz, the Latin Grammy and Premio Lo Nuestro-winning merengue sensation, took the stage. The Miami-born Dominican artist captivated the audience, and emotions ran high when he kissed his mother, author Milagros Sánchez, as he performed one of his hits.

In recognition of his contributions to Dominican music, the Consulate honored Manny Cruz, along with merengue legend Aramis Camilo, for their artistic achievements and their role in promoting Dominican culture worldwide.

A STAR-STUDDED CELEBRATION

The event saw Dominican celebrities and influencers dancing to the electrifying rhythm of Manny Cruz and Aramis Camilo, including Amara La Negra, Lourdes Stephen, Robmariel Olea, Madellyn González from Univision, actress Wendy Regalado, and special guests such as Diario Las Américas director Ileana Lavastida and influencer Keiry Franco.

Before the spectacular dance party, the evening featured an exquisite dinner and a charity auction of an artwork depicting the Virgen de la Altagracia, which was won by Amara La Negra.

A CELEBRATION OF DOMINICAN IDENTITY

Dressed elegantly, with many wearing patriotic colors, attendees enjoyed iconic Dominican merengues performed by Manny Cruz and Aramis Camilo, who joined him on stage for an unforgettable closing performance.

In her final remarks, the Consul General expressed gratitude to Acroarte Florida, represented by José Rosario, as well as the entire consular and INDEX team, for organizing a flawless celebration. The night also featured the “Hora Loca”, a vibrant display of festive outfits and accessories in Dominican national colors.

A STRONG BUSINESS PRESENCE

Several prominent Dominican brands proudly sponsored the gala, including Crisol, Salami Estelar, Sky High Dominicana, Banreservas, Café Santo Domingo, Autoridad Portuaria, IDAC, and Miami Best Wheels, reinforcing the strong connection between the Dominican business sector and its diaspora.

The Dominican Independence Celebration in Miami was not just an event—it was a powerful testament to the pride, unity, and resilience of Dominicans abroad. A night filled with music, patriotism, and unforgettable moments, it set a new standard for honoring Dominican heritage in the diaspora.

Carlos Azuaje’s sculpture

“Origin”

by Carlos Azuaje A Profound Reflection on Creation and Existence

Currently on display at the Sculptures on the Lawn exhibit in front of the Orange County Administration Building, Carlos Azuaje’s Origin captivates visitors with its striking form and profound symbolism. The sculpture, a giant hand lifting a rock, explores the duality of creation—are we shaping the universe, or is it shaping us?

Inspired by Orlando’s history, Azuaje originally envisioned a hand holding an orange, symbolizing Florida’s origins. As the concept evolved, it took on a more universal meaning. The hand, painted as a star-filled cosmos, emerges from a rock, blurring the lines between the natural and the constructed. It holds another rock—perhaps a planet, an asteroid, or just stone—inviting viewers to contemplate existence, responsibility, and human impact on the world.

Technically, the sculpture masterfully combines epoxy cement over a metal structure, creating a balance between raw natural texture and precise geometric forms. The transition between these elements suggests evolution—how human intervention shapes the world around us.

Beyond its visual impact, Origin engages viewers on a philosophical level. It raises questions about creation, duality, and our role in the universe. The piece does not dictate meaning but invites interpretation: Are we holding up the universe, or is it holding us?

Origin is not just a sculpture—it is a conversation between art, poetry, and philosophy, leaving space for every viewer to find their own meaning.

Parenting Success FOR

As parents, we all want our children to be successful and live fulfilling lives. However, success doesn’t begin in adulthood—it starts from the moment a child is born. The foundation for success is built when parents are intentional in creating a culture that fosters excellence at home. This starts with establishing consistent routines that help children develop autonomy and responsibility as they grow, as well as give them a sense of security. It’s also important for parents to allow their children to face the consequences of their actions. Saving them from these consequences will only perpetuate immaturity.

Encouraging children to develop and cultivate their natural talents will help them become skilled at things they truly enjoy, giving them a sense of capability. Moreover, exposing them to enriching experiences can expand their dreams and shape their future aspirations. Alongside these practical steps, instilling faith and offering spiritual guidance provide them with a moral compass that will serve them throughout their lives.

By being intentional, supportive, consistent, and creating a faith-filled environment, parents can set their children on a path toward success—not just in their careers, but in becoming well-rounded, responsible, and self-motivated individuals.

SUCCESSFUL LAUNCH OF THE BOOK ADHD, TRAUMA, AND PURPOSE

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ic – February 20, 2024 – In a night filled with emotion and meaning, author Raquel Quezada presented her tenth book, ADHD, Trauma, and Purpose: An Interwoven Journey, at Grey Café in the Dominican Republic. This deeply personal work tells Quezada’s story of living with ADHD, navigating trauma, and ultimately discovering her life’s purpose.

The event was graced by the distinguished presence of Alfredo Pacheco, President of the Chamber of Deputies, who expressed admiration for the author’s courage in sharing her journey and her commitment to raising awareness about ADHD.

Veteran broadcaster Jatnna Tavárez hosted the evening, creating an intimate and heartfelt atmosphere. Tavárez emphasized the importance of open conversations about ADHD and the profound impact understanding it can have. “Raquel is a testament to the fact that one can live fully with ADHD and achieve all their goals,” she remarked.

During the presentation, Raquel Quezada shared excerpts from her book, offering insight into her writing process and how it helped her embrace and understand her condition.

“This book is a gift for anyone who has ever felt different or misunderstood,” Quezada shared. “I hope my story inspires others to find their own path and never give up.”

ADHD, Trauma, and Purpose: An Interwoven Journey is now available in bookstores nationwide and on digital platforms.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

Raquel Quezada is a renowned broadcaster and passionate advocate for the rights of individuals with disabilities. She has dedicated her life to education and supporting families and communities, championing a more inclusive and informed society. A Dominican native living in Boston, she is married to entrepreneur Jonathan Quezada and is the mother of four children. Turning her challenges into a source of inspiration, she continues to be a pillar of support for the Hispanic community.

Raquel is the founder and director of Chan ging the World for People with Disabilities, a foundation dedicated to educating and guiding parents of children with disabilities, fostering their inclusion in various social spheres. She also hosts and produces Changing the World, an internationally broadcast radio and television program. Additionally, she created the first Spa nish-language program designed for parents of children with disabilities, equipping them with tools, knowledge, and skills to advocate for their children’s rights.

TOWARDS ECOLOGICAL, BUSINESS, AND CORPORATE TOURISM

On December 29, 2024, the Ministry of Tourism and Punta Cana International Airport celebrated the arrival of the 11 millionth visitor, surpassing last year’s record of 10 million. This milestone positions the Dominican Republic as a leader in tourism relative to its population in the Americas.

While most visitors come for the beaches and cultural landmarks, reaching 20 million tourists will require diversifying into ecotourism, business tourism, and corporate tourism. Ecotourism boosts boutique hotels, rural stays, and local products, while business tourism attracts investors exploring opportunities in the country’s stable economy.

Existing ecotourism initiatives include Grupo Rizek’s “Cocoa Trail” and Rancho Don Rey near Los Haitises National Park. Mountain destinations like Constanza and Jarabacoa offer scenic landscapes, cool climates, and adventure experiences.

With leadership from the Ministry of Tourism and support from institutions like Unicaribe University, the country is preparing to expand business tourism in established hubs like Casa de Campo, Punta Cana, and Cap Cana, as well as emerging destinations like Pedernales. President Luis Abinader and Minister David Collado are committed to driving this new phase of tourism growth.

NEUROEDUCATION AND

Women’s Entrepreneurship

The Key to Growth and Equality

In a world that is constantly evolving, education stands as the driving force behind social and economic progress. For women, continuous learning and professional development have become essential tools for breaking barriers and fostering equality in the workplace and business world. In Latin American countries like the Dominican Republic, women have taken the lead in higher education, surpassing men in enrollment rates. According to the Ministry of Higher Education, Science, and Technology (MESCyT), 64% of university students in the Dominican Republic are women— a trend that is mirrored across the region. This educational shift has played a crucial role in expanding female participation in key economic sectors and entrepreneurship. However, the gender wage gap persists: in Latin America, women still earn an average of 17% less than men for the same roles, according to the International Labour Organization (ILO).

Neuroeducation: Learning as the Foundation for Entrepreneurship.

From a neuroscience perspective, learning is a fundamental process for human adaptation and evolution. Renowned neuroscientist Dr. Francisco Mora explains that the brain learns by forming connections and associations between experiences—a process that is significantly enhanced by emotion. According to Mora, "You can only truly learn what you love," emphasizing the critical role of passion and curiosity in education. Neuroeducation highlights the brain’s plasticity, meaning that learning is a lifelong process, constantly reshaping our knowledge and skills—an essential trait for entrepreneurs.

For women in business, this ability to adapt and embrace continuous learning becomes a major competitive advantage. Understanding the neuroscience of learning not only strengthens leadership and decision-making skills but also

enables female entrepreneurs to navigate rapidly changing markets more effectively. The emotional connection to learning fosters resilience, a crucial factor for those launching and sustaining a business in today’s dynamic environment.

Women, Entrepreneurship, and Education: A Cycle of Empowerment

The rise of female entrepreneurship in Latin America is directly linked to increased access to education and professional training. Women who invest in learning are not just opening doors for their own careers—they are also driving innovation and economic growth. However, structural barriers, such as the gender pay gap and unequal access to funding, continue to hinder progress.

Neuroeducation provides powerful tools to accelerate women’s empowerment. By understanding how the brain processes

learning and decision-making, women can refine their problem-solving abilities, strengthen emotional intelligence, and enhance their leadership skills. The challenge now is to integrate this knowledge into the business world, where education is recognized not just as a requirement but as a strategic advantage in building a more equitable society.

The future of women’s entrepreneurship in Latin America depends on education with a purpose—one that transforms, empowers, and creates opportunities. Because when a woman learns, she doesn’t just change her own life—she transforms entire communities.

Official Appointment

Pamela Zoelin Ramírez soto

as Head of the Office of Services in Orlando

Orlando, FL – January 30, 2025 –Business is pleased to officially announce the appointment of Pamela Zoelin Ramírez Soto as the new Head of the Office of Services in Orlando, Florida. This decision was confirmed by the Junta Central Electoral (JCE) of the Dominican Republic during an Administrative Session held on January 28, 2025 (Act No. 01/2025).

Ms. Ramírez Soto previously served as the Coordinator for Circumscription 02 of the Directorate of the Dominican Vote Abroad. Her extensive experience in electoral processes, community service, and diaspora engagement makes her well-suited to lead the Office of Services in Orlando.

In her new role, she will oversee operations that support the Dominican community abroad, ensuring the effective management of electoral and administrative services. This appointment reflects the commitment of the JCE and Yes Bu siness to strengthening institutional leadership and enhancing services for Dominicans residing in the United States.

Yes Business congratulates Ms. Ramírez Soto on this well-deserved appointment and looks forward to the continued success of the Office of Services under her leadership.

EDDY HERRERA

REÚNE A GRANDES MÚSICOS EN SU NUEVO MERENGUE

Miami, FL, 6 de febrero de 2025 – Eddy Herrera inicia el año con fuerza y ritmo, presentando su nuevo sencillo “Y Cómo Te Olvido”, una propuesta vibrante que reafirma su legado en el merengue. Tras una exitosa gira internacional, el galardonado artista regresa con esta producción que ya resuena en la radio y promete conquistar al público.

El lanzamiento de “Y Cómo Te Olvido” coincide con un momento especial en la carrera de Herrera, quien recientemente fue nominado a los Premios Soberano en las categorías Merenguero del Año y Merengue del Añopor “Quiero Más”.

El tema, compuesto por Giordano Morel y producido por Junior Cabrera, destaca no solo por su energía contagiosa, sino por la excelencia musical que lo respalda.

Para esta entrega, El Galán del Merengue reunió a un elenco excepcional de músicos, entre ellos Ramón Orlando, Krispín Fernández, Isaías Leclerc, Juan De La Cruz (Johnny Chocolate), Rafael Carrasco, Luis Mojica, José Luis Mateo y José Flete, creando una fusión impecable de talento y tradición.

“Para mí es más que un honor lanzar mi primera canción del año con el respaldo de estos maestros. Es un lujo tener a estos caballeros y grandes profesionales en este merengue creado con tanto amor por Giordano Morel y sé que mi gente se lo va a disfrutar”, expresó Eddy Herrera.

El sencillo viene acompañado de un videoclip disponible en el canal oficial de YouTube de Eddy Herrera. Bajo la producción de Claudio De La Cruz y la dirección fotográfica de Adrián Díaz y Jaime King, el audiovisual complementa a la perfección la esencia y pasión de este nuevo lanzamiento.

Con “Y Cómo Te Olvido”, Eddy Herrera da inicio a un año prometedor, reafirmando su lugar como una de las figuras más emblemáticas del merengue.

Business Success

The 5 C's of YOUR BLUEPRINT FOR GROWTH

Success in business isn’t luck—it’s strategy. Through years of experience, I’ve identified five key principles that set thriving businesses apart. These are the 5 Cs of Business Success: Believe, Create, Communicate, Connect, and Capitalize. Mastering these will take your business from survival mode to long-term success.

1. BELIEVE

The Foundation of Success

Every great business starts with an unshakable belief in its mission. If you don’t have confidence in your vision, no one else will. Your belief fuels persistence, and persistence turns ideas into reality.

2. CREATE

Turning Vision into Action

Ideas alone don’t build businesses—execution does. Create solutions that solve real problems, structure efficient systems, and innovate continuously. Success belongs to those who act.

3. COMMUNICATE

Make Your Brand Stand Out

A great product means nothing if no one knows about it. Your brand isn’t just a logo; it’s your message. Craft a compelling story, market strategically, and ensure your audience understands your value.

4. CONNECT

Build Relationships That Drive Success

Business thrives on trust and relationships. Whether with clients, partners, or mentors, meaningful connections open doors to new opportunities and growth.

5. CAPITALIZE

Convert Effort into Profit

A business without a financial strategy is just an expensive hobby. Price your offerings wisely, optimize costs, and ensure your business is not just growing but thriving sustainably.

A New Era of Leadership at HAPBWA

SWEARING-IN CEREMONY FOR THE NEW BOARD OF DIRECTORS

ORLANDO CITY HALL HOSTS A NIGHT OF UNITY AND INNOVATION FOR WOMEN ENTREPRENEURS

In a ceremony filled with inspiration, unity, and a shared vision for the future, the Hispanoamericana Association of Women Entrepreneurs (HAPBWA) celebrated the swearing-in of its new board of directors at Orlando City Hall. This prestigious event marked the beginning of a new chapter under the leadership of Jackie Barboza, an outstanding Peruvian entrepreneur, who takes the helm as the organization’s new President.

In her powerful inaugural speech, Barboza emphasized unity and business innovation as the guiding principles of her leadership. She expressed her commitment to empowering women entrepreneurs, fostering collaboration, and driving economic growth within the Hispanic business community.

A STRONG TEAM FOR A STRONGER FUTURE

Supporting Barboza in this transformative journey is an exceptional team of dedicated professionals, each bringing their expertise and passion to HAPBWA’s mission:

Fabrina Laprea, an outstanding entrepreneur in the health sector, assumes the role of Vice President.

Linsy Diprieto takes charge of Development, focusing on expansion and impact.

Beatriz Andrekovich steps in as Secretary, ensuring smooth operations.

Aixa takes on the role of Treasurer, managing financial strategies.

Jeanette, as Director of Membership, will enhance community engagement.

Mayra La Paz, as Director of Public Relations and Communication, will lead outreach initiatives.

A COMMUNITY UNITED IN SUPPORT

The event gathered an array of political and community leaders, along with representatives from the HAPBYse Foundation, all coming together to endorse and celebrate this new leadership team. Judge Gisela Laurent, a distinguished figure of Dominican heritage, had the honor of officiating the swearing-in, adding a touch of prestige to the occasion.

RECOGNIZING LEADERSHIP AND LEGACY

The ceremony also served as a moment of gratitude and recognition. Matty Frías, the outgoing president and a highly respected leader, expressed heartfelt appreciation to the members for their unwavering support. She highlighted the extraordinary achievements of her tenure and paid tribute to the founding leaders of HAPBWA, including Gladys Casteleiro, Adolfina Mejía, and Ivan, whose vision laid the foundation for the organization’s success.

Additionally, a special recognition was awarded to Luis Martinez, the Hispanic Affairs representative of Orlando’s Mayor, for his continuous support and strong alliance with HAPBWA. This acknowledgment underscores the importance of partnerships in fostering professional women’s growth and success.

A FUTURE BUILT ON EXCELLENCE AND COLLABORATION

With 27 years of impact and empowerment, HAPBWA continues to stand as a pillar of strength for Hispanic women entrepreneurs. The newly appointed board is set to drive forward initiatives that will enhance opportunities, promote business excellence, and strengthen the network of professional women in Orlando and beyond.

The evening concluded with a blessing from Dr. Diana Mejía, symbolizing a prosperous journey ahead.

As HAPBWA embarks on this exciting new era, one thing is clear—the spirit of leadership, unity, and innovation will continue to thrive, shaping a brighter future for women entrepreneurs everywhere.
